Making a Miyawaki Pocket Forest Demystified

Thursday 13th of November 2025 4:00 pm

This introductory workshop* is aimed at local groups and aspiring project coordinators in the Perth inner city region who want to make a Miyawaki pocket forest and will provide participants with an understanding of what is required to plan and make a pocket forest. It will feature presentations by Dr Grey Coupland of Murdoch University who has made around 20 pocket forests in south west Western Australia and Ian Kininmonth, project coordinator of  Transition Town Vincent’s (TTV) Black Cockatoo forest project.

 

With the guidance of Dr Grey Coupland, community group Transition Town Vincent (TTV) were able to gather and mobilise the local community to make a Black Cockatoo pocket forest in just 6 months in 2025. Having developed the knowledge and skills to make their first pocket forest, TTV are now in the process of making another pocket forest nearby while supporting other local groups who may want to make a Miyawaki pocket forest.

Participants will get an overview of the process for planning and making a Miyawaki pocket forest, what needs to be done when and by who and information on resources to help you plan and make a pocket forest. The aim is to support this workshop with more detailed  workshops on specific issues (e.g. soil health basics, setting up and operating a community compost hub).
